Kind of Scooter
Three-Wheel Scooters: More maneuverable, suitable for indoor use.Four-Wheel Scooters: More stable, better for outside use on unequal surface.Travel scooters for sale near me, Www.jccer.com,: Compact and lightweight, simple to take apart for transportation.
Battery Life and Range
Average Range: 10-30 miles per charge.Factor to consider: Choose a scooter with a variety that satisfies your everyday needs and has a reputable battery.
Speed and Performance
Leading Speed: 3-8 miles per hour.Surface: Ensure the scooter can handle the kinds of surface areas you regularly come across.
Weight Capacity
Common Capacities: 250-500 pounds.Factor to consider: Select a model that can securely support your weight.
Functions and Accessories
Essential Features: Adjustable seat, tilt function, and a comfortable driving position.Optional Accessories: Basket, cane holder, oxygen tank holder, and additional lighting.
Maintenance and Support
Warranty: Look for an extensive service warranty that covers parts and labor.Client Support: Check the schedule of local service centers and consumer assistance.
Mobility
Weight and Size: Consider the weight and size of the scooter if you prepare to carry it.Disassembly: Some models can be quickly dismantled for cars and truck travel.FAQs About Senior Scooters
Q: Are senior scooters covered by insurance coverage?
A: Some insurance coverage strategies, consisting of Medicare, may cover part or all of the cost of a senior scooter if it is considered clinically required. It's important to examine with your insurance coverage provider to understand the coverage and any needed paperwork.
Q: How do I select the ideal size for a senior scooter?
A: The ideal size depends upon your height, weight, and comfort needs. The majority of scooters have adjustable seats and handlebars to accommodate different body types. Visit a regional shop to evaluate various models and find the one that fits you best.
Q: What is the average cost of a senior scooter?
A: The expense can differ commonly depending upon the type, brand name, and functions. Standard models start around ₤ 500, while high-end scooters can cost over ₤ 3,000. Used scooters are frequently more affordable and can be found for a couple of hundred dollars.
Q: How do I maintain my senior scooter?
A: Regular maintenance includes:Charging the Battery: Follow the manufacturer's standards for charging frequency and period.Inspecting Tires: Ensure tires are properly pumped up and in great condition.Examining Brakes and Lights: Regularly check and replace as needed.Cleaning: Wipe down the scooter to keep it clean and devoid of dirt and particles.
Q: Are there any security features I should look for?
A: Yes, essential safety functions include:Brakes: Both front and rear brakes for much better control.Lights: Front and rear lights for exposure, specifically in low-light conditions.Reflectors: Enhance security when utilizing the scooter during the night.Safety belt: For included security.Emergency Stop Button: Quick and easy access to stop the scooter in an emergency.
Q: Can I use a senior scooter inside and outdoors?
A: Yes, numerous senior scooters are developed for both indoor and outside use. Nevertheless, three-wheel scooters are typically better for indoor use due to their maneuverability, while four-wheel scooters are more stable for outdoor use on unequal surface.
Q: How do I charge a senior scooter?
A: Most scooters include a charger that can be plugged into a standard electric outlet. It's essential to follow the maker's directions for charging to ensure the battery lasts and performs well. Charging times can vary, generally varying from 6 to 12 hours.Top Brands and Models
